Block

#20,536,653
Block Number
20,536,653 @ 01/03/2025, 09:06:00
Status
Finalized
ID
0x01395d4df63ca130cf3b69510d464d1c4dec889eb7a767446db83dbf44e63fab
Transactions
Gas Used
1649525/39960938 (4.13% Used)
Total Score
2,004,787,937 (+99)
Rewards
6.16 VTHO